HTML 5 <img> 標簽
定義和用法
<img> 標簽定義圖像。
HTML 4.01 與 HTML 5 之間的差異
在 HTML 4.01 中,圖像的 "align", "border", "hspace" 以及 "vspace" 不贊成使用。在 HTML 5 中,不再支持這些屬性。
例子
<img src="smile.gif" alt="smile" />
屬性
屬性 | 值 | 描述 | 4 | 5 |
---|---|---|---|---|
alt | text | 定義有關圖形的短的描述。 | 4 | 5 |
src | URL | 要顯示的圖像的 URL。 | 4 | 5 |
align |
|
規(guī)定如何根據周圍的文本來對齊圖像。不支持。請使用 CSS 代替。 | 4 | ? |
border | pixels | 定義圖像周圍的邊框。不支持。請使用 CSS 代替。 | 4 | ? |
height | pixels % | 定義圖像的高度。 | 4 | 5 |
hspace | pixels | 定義圖像左側和右側的空白。不支持。請使用 CSS 代替。 | 4 | ? |
ismap | URL | 把圖像定義為服務器端的圖像映射。 | 4 | 5 |
longdesc | URL? | 一個 URL,指向了描述該圖像的文檔。不支持。 | 4 | ? |
usemap | URL | 定義作為客戶端圖像映射的一幅圖像。請參閱 <map> 和 <area> 標簽,了解其工作原理。 | 4 | 5 |
vspace | pixels | 定義圖像頂部和底部的空白。不支持。請使用 CSS 代替。 | 4 | 5 |
width | pixels % | 設置圖像的寬度。 | 4 | 5 |
標準屬性
class, contenteditable, contextmenu, dir, draggable, id, irrelevant, lang, ref, registrationmark, tabindex, template, title
如需完整的描述,請訪問 HTML 5 中標準屬性。
事件屬性
onabort, onbeforeunload, onblur, onchange, onclick, oncontextmenu, ondblclick, ondrag, ondragend, ondragenter, ondragleave, ondragover, ondragstart, ondrop, onerror, onfocus, onkeydown, onkeypress, onkeyup, onload, onmessage, onmousedown, onmousemove, onmouseover, onmouseout, onmouseup, onmousewheel, onresize, onscroll, onselect, onsubmit, onunload
如需完整的描述,請訪問 HTML 5 中事件屬性。
TIY 實例
- 插入圖像
- 本例演示如何在網頁中顯示圖像。
- 從不同的位置插入圖片
- 本例演示如何將其他文件夾或服務器的圖片顯示到網頁中。
- 浮動圖像
- 本例演示如何使圖片浮動至段落的左邊或右邊。
- 調整圖像尺寸
- 本例演示如何將圖片調整到不同的尺寸。
- 制作圖像鏈接
- 本例演示如何將圖像作為一個鏈接使用。
- 創(chuàng)建圖像地圖
- 本例顯示如何創(chuàng)建帶有可供點擊區(qū)域的圖像地圖。其中的每個區(qū)域都是一個超級鏈接。